Biomass composite material wall modules and processing technology thereof

The invention provides a composite material of environmental protection wall module, which mainly consists of a plant fiber, a self-made biomass adhesive, a moisture proofing agent, a biomass perfume etc., wherein the plant fiber comprises various crop straws and smashed sawdust which is cut into a length of 1 to 8 cm; the self-made biomass adhesive comprises a modified corn starch adhesive, a tapioca starch adhesive, a soybean crude protein adhesive and a trash for sugar beet processing; the moisture proofing agent is a calcium oxide; the perfume includes lavender, camphor tree particulate and argy wormwood. The wall consists of an internal wall surface and an external wall surface wherein the internal wall surface is abrasive, which is easy to ensure surface to be finished when in interior decoration; furthermore, the perfume such as the lavender, the camphor tree particulates and the argy wormwood etc. are added, so that a fragrance generated from the perfume gives out slowly when the wall is in use, and the goal of beautifying the indoor air environment and anti mosquitoes are achieved. The external wall surface is fine sand coated to form a smooth and rigid housing which can improve the strength of the surface and be good for ventilation of outer atmosphere. The production flow comprises straw pre-treatment, cutting off, batching, adhesive spraying, burden distribution, repressing, hot pressing and modular processing. The production process meets the integral idea of sustainable development, which is characterizes in the outstanding energy saving effect, the simple technology and the low cost. The material prepared has light weight, excellent environmental protection performance and outstanding water and fire proof performance. The production material has wide source, which is characterized by the high strength, good tenacity and excellent seismic behavior.

Active micromolecular ecological nutrition agent and use method thereof

InactiveCN104230406AThe treatment reaction is completely and thoroughlyImprove fertilizer efficiencyFertilising methodsWeight gainingTillage
The invention discloses an active micromolecular ecological nutrition agent and a use method thereof. The nutrition agent is obtained by taking organic waste as the raw material, carrying out subcritical water treatment under 180-280DEG C and 1.2-7.5Mpa for 40-90min, and then performing solid-liquid separation. In a solid fertilizer, the content of organic matters is 70-90%, the content of total nutrients is 4-6%, the content of amino acid is greater than or equal to 20%, the content of humus is greater than or equal to 45%, the content of trace elements is greater than or equal to 0.5%, and the pH is 4-6. In a liquid fertilizer, the content of organic matters is 50-120g/L, the content of total nutrients is 500-950mg/L, the content of amino acid is greater than or equal to 10g/L, the content of humus is greater than or equal to 20g/L, the content of trace elements is greater than or equal to 200mg/kg, and the pH is 4-6. According to the use method, in addition to be used for topdressing, the solid fertilizer can be applied individually or mixed with other fertilizers, can be used for furrow fertilization, row fertilization, hole fertilization or spray fertilization and rotary tillage, and the dosage for every 666.67 square meters is 200-850kg. The liquid fertilizer can be used for flushing fertilization, jet fertilization, spray fertilization or drop irrigation with water, and the dosage for every 666.67 square meters is 20-200kg. The organic fertilizer involved in the invention has higher fertilizer efficiency and activity, can make fruit tree single fruit reach a weight gain of 7-15%, melons and fruits reach a yield increase of 10-20%, grains reach a yield increase of 5-16%, and vegetables reach a yield increase of 8-20%. Also, the quality, growth and soil indexes are improved, fertilizer consumption is greatly reduced, resources are saved and environmental protection is achieved.

Optical system of satellite-borne differential absorption spectrometer

An optical system of satellite-borne differential absorption spectrometer comprises a relay optical system and an Offner imaging spectrometer system. The relay optical system is composed of a relay reflector, relay lenses and a color separation filter. The Offner imaging spectrometer system is composed of an incident slit, a convex grating, and a concave reflector. The relay optical system uses the color separation filter to split a detection waveband to form four channels, which are focused by four groups of relay lenses to the incident slit of the spectrometer. Light at each waveband entersthe spectrometer from the incident slit of the spectrometer, is split by the convex grating, and has the light path turned and focused on a detector. The invention utilizes a relay reflector to turn the light path, and utilizes the color separation filter to split the detection waveband into four channels, to therefore improve the detection resolution of the system, ensure measurement accuracy and realize compact volume of the whole optical system. The Offner imaging spectrometer has excellent imaging spectrum performance and reduced distortion. The invention facilitates miniaturization and weight reduction of the whole system, and is suitable for space technology.

Preparation method of transparent mesoporous titanium dioxide hydrophobic/ultra-hydrophilic functional thin film

The invention relates to a preparation method of a transparent mesoporous titanium dioxide hydrophobic/ultra-hydrophilic functional thin film. The method includes the steps of: 1) preparation of a precursor sol: diluting titanate in an alcohol solution, adding a stabilizer acetylacetone to prepare a solution A, dissolving a surfactant in the alcohol solution or a mixture liquid of alcohol and water to prepare a solution B, dropwisely adding the solution B into the solution A to prepare a mixed solution, regulating the pH value of the mixed solution to 2-5 and stirring the mixed solution until stable sol is formed; 2) coating of the sol: spray-coating a surface of a substrate with the sol, and performing thermal treatment to prepare the hydrophobic/ultra-hydrophilic titanium dioxide thin film. Through selection of different surfactants, different thin films having ultra-hydrophilic or strong-hydrophobic performances can be produced on the same production line through the same technology, so that the preparation method is suitable for different demands on products in large-scale industrial production. The thin film actually achieves the ultra-hydrophilic/strong-hydrophobic functions (a contact angle is less than 5 degrees or is more than 130 degrees).

Semiconductor device used for SOI (silicon-on-insulator) high-voltage integrated circuit

The invention relates to a semiconductor device used for an SOI (silicon-on-insulator) high-voltage integrated circuit, belonging to the field of power semiconductor devices. The semiconductor device comprises a semiconductor substrate layer, a dielectric buried layer and a silicon top layer, wherein at least high-voltage LIGBT (lateral insulated gate bipolar transistor), NLDMOS (N-type lateral double-diffused metal-oxide semiconductor) and PLDMOS (P-type lateral double-diffused metal-oxide semiconductor) devices are integrated in the silicon top layer; the thickness of the dielectric buried layer is not more than 5 mum; the thickness of the silicon top layer is not more than 20 mum; multiple incontinuous high-concentration N<+> regions (doping concentration is not lower than 1e16e cm<-3>) are formed at the bottoms of the high-voltage devices and the silicon top layer above the surface of the dielectric buried layer; the high-voltage devices are isolated by dielectric isolation regions; low-voltage MOS (metal oxide semiconductor) devices can also be integrated in the device; the high-voltage devices and low-voltage devices are isolated by the dielectric isolation regions; and different low-voltage devices are isolated by field oxidation layers. The semiconductor device has the advantages that: because of the introduction of the multiple incontinuous high-concentration N<+> regions, the electric field of the silicon top layer is weakened and the electric field of the dielectric buried layer is enhanced at the same time, the breakdown voltage of the device is greatly improved, and the device can be applied in high-voltage integrated circuits in the automobile electronics, consumption electronics, green lighting, industrial control, power supply management, display driving and other fields.

Solid-liquid phase change material melting heat transfer performance parameter testing system and method thereof

The invention discloses a solid-liquid phase change material melting heat transfer performance parameter testing system and a method thereof. The system comprises a phase change material container, a liquid phase material expansion port, an expansion tube provided with a liquid level sensor, a heat insulation sleeve, an analog-to-digital converter and a computer; a solid-liquid phase change material is contained in the cavity of the phase change material container, the top of the symmetrical center of the phase change material container is provided with the liquid phase material expansion port, the liquid phase material expansion port is connected with the expansion tube provided with the liquid level sensor, the expansion tube provided with the liquid level sensor is wrapped by the heat insulation sleeve, a liquid level simulation signal of the liquid level sensor is transmitted into the analog-to-digital converter in real time, and a data signal derived by the analog-to-digital converter is transmitted to the computer. Automatic measurement, operation and display of the melting rate, the integral heat exchange coefficient and other key heat transfer performance parameters of a phase change material in an internal non-visual container can be realized within a certain precision range through reasonable hypothesis and strict derivation based on volume expansion data in the solid-liquid phase change melting process.

Optical system of large-field wide-band airborne differential absorption imaging spectrometer

InactiveCN109489817AHigh radiation energy utilization efficiencyRadiation energy utilization efficiency is improvedAbsorption/flicker/reflection spectroscopyCamera lensGrating
The invention discloses an optical system of a large-field wide-band airborne differential absorption imaging spectrometer, which comprises a front telescopic imaging system and an Offner-Littrow spectral imaging system, wherein the front telescopic imaging system mainly comprises a front ultraviolet objective lens; the Offner-Littrow spectral imaging system specifically comprises an optical filter, an incident slit, a convex grating and a concave reflector; the front ultraviolet objective lens consists of three independent front lenses according to detection wavebands (200-276 nm, 276-380 nm,380-500 nm), and the field of view of each lens reaches 40 degree. The Offner-Littrow spectral imaging system is also independently composed of three spectrometers according to the above wavebands. Each waveband light is focused from a front lens and enters the incident slit of the spectrometer, three groups of spectra to be detected enter the spectrometer through the optical filter at the rear end of the incident slit of the spectrometer, the corresponding spectral information is reflected by the concave reflector and then is split by the convex grating, and the light path is turned to the concave reflector and then focused on a detector. According to the optical system of the large-field wide-band airborne differential absorption imaging spectrometer, the measurement accuracy is ensured, and the whole optical system is compact in size.
